轻量化头盔共形天线及纺织柔性化研究进展

【摘要】 随着无线通信技术的快速发展,不同领域对无线通信的要求日益提高。可穿戴天线因其小型化、柔性化和利于携带等特点,成为研究的重点。其中,头盔天线作为可穿戴天线的主要组成部分,对于需要佩戴头盔的特种人群尤为重要。综述国内外头盔天线的研究进展,对目前主流的头盔天线形式进行分类探讨,并结合当下热门的可穿戴纺织柔性电子技术,总结头盔天线结构、集成、柔性化和发展方向,着重讨论头盔天线的性能现状及影响因素,分析头盔天线的现有问题,并展望头盔天线的纺织柔性化等未来发展方向。

【Abstract】 With the rapid development of wireless communication technology, the requirements for wireless communication in different fields are increasing. Wearable antennas have become the focus of research because of their miniaturization, flexibility and portable-friendly features. Among them, helmet antenna, as a general component of wearable antennas, is of great significance especially for the special people who needs to wear helmets. The current mainstream helmet antenna forms were classified and discussed by summarizing the research progress of helmet antennas at home and abroad. And combined with the current popular wearable textile flexible electronic technology, the helmet antenna structure, integration, flexibility and development direction were summarized, and the performance status of helmet antennas and its influencing factors were mainly discussed, the existing problems of helmet antennas were analyzed and the future development direction such as the textile flexibility of helmet antennas was looked forward to.
